Turbulence
tur·bu·lence


Definition/Meaning
(noun)
A state of violent or unsteady movement of air or water.

e.g. The plane hit turbulence, causing drinks to spill everywhere.

(noun)
a state of great conflict, agitation, commotion, or confusion;

e.g. They were thrown into turbulence by the unexpected setback.
